蓖麻油聚氨酯半互穿网络聚合物的合成与性能研究

摘    要:以甲苯二异氰酸酯分别与甲基丙烯酸羟乙酯和丙烯酸羟丙酯及蓖麻油作用合成了两种预聚体;然后再分别与甲基丙烯酸羟乙酯、甲基丙烯酸羟丙酯、丙烯酸羟乙酯、丙烯酸羟丙酯及苯乙烯5种单体混合.在紫外光照射下形成半互穿网络聚合物样品。分析结果表明.第一种预聚体的系列样品拉伸强度高.伸长率低;而第二种预聚体的系列样品则伸长率较高.拉伸强度较低。另外,这两种预聚体和苯乙烯单体形成的样品综合性能都比其他样品要好。

关 键 词:半互穿网络聚合物  交联密度  互穿程度

Synthesis and Properties of Castor Oil Polyurethane With Semi-interpenetrating Polymer Network

Abstract:Two types of prepolymers of polyurethane , named as PU1 and PU2, were prepared respectively from the systems of toluene diisocyanate ( TDI) /hydroxypropyl methacrylate ( HPM A) /castor oil and TDI/hydroxypropyl acrylate (HPA) /castor oil. The PU1 and PU2 were mixed separately with the monomers of hydroxyethyl acrylate ( HEA) , HPA, HEMA, hydroxylpropyl methacrylate (HPMA) and styrene (St) . Then, the reactants were illuminated with ultraviolet light in the presence of benzoin methyl ether (BME) as photosensitizer to form the semi-IPN.
Keywords:semi-IPN  crosslink density  extent of interpenetration
